Ingredients to make Macaroni with leftover meat:

  1. 1 medium onion
  2. 2 green peppers
  3. 1 piece of cooked or stewed beef
  4. 1 splash of olive oil
  5. 300 grams of macaroni
  6. 3 pieces of butter
  7. 1 pinch of Salt and Pepper
  8. 1 pinch of oregano
  9. 1 pinch of thyme
  10. 100 grams of Cheese to gratin
  11. 6 slices of semi-cured cheese
  12. 400 grams of fried tomato

How to make Macaroni with Leftover Meat:

  • To make this fantastic recipe for use, we begin by preparing the ingredient sand by covering the base of a saucepan with olive oil.
  • Finely chop the onion and peppers, previously washed. The meat of the puchero or stew is also cut into small pieces.
  • Once all this is done, we heat the oil and add the ingredients to the saucepan to make a base sauce. Season with salt and pepper and add oregano and thyme to taste, as well as 3 pieces of butter.
  • We keep cooking the sauce for 15 minutes over low heat.
  • Remember that to make these macaroni with leftover meat you can use any type of cooked meat, preferably a good piece that you have left over from an Argentine stew, for example.
  • To make the macaroni, we put a saucepan with water on the highest heat. When it starts to boil, add the macaroni and wait 15 minutes for them to be al dente.
  • If you prefer to make this macaroni and meat recipe using another type of pasta, remember to check the manufacturer’s recommended cooking time.
  • Once the 15 minutes of cooking have passed, we put the macaroni in a strainer and drain the pasta well.
  • Next, we add the macaroni to the pot where we have the sauce and mix everything well. It’s important that the pasta blend into the flavors of the stir-fry, so give it a good stir at this point.
  • Now we add the fried tomato, the special cheese for gratin and arrange the slices of semi-cured cheese in the shape of a star, as seen in the photo.
  • Then, to finish cooking our macaroni and meat dish, we put the lid on the saucepan and put it on a low heat until we see that the cheese has melted with the pasta.
